Kylie Minogue is a renowned Australian singer, songwriter, and actress. She began her career at a young age by appearing in Australian television series such as Skyways, The Sullivans, The Henderson Kids, and Neighbours. It was Neighbours that helped her gain recognition in the UK. Subsequently, an English record company, PWL (Pete Waterman Limited), gave her a recording contract. Over the years, Kylie has released many hit albums, including Kylie, Kylie Minogue, Fever, Rhythm of Love, and Body Language. She has also acted in several films. Her concerts are considered iconic, and she is widely regarded as a global style icon. Her charisma and stage presence have often drawn comparisons to Madonna. While Madonna is known as the "Queen of Pop," Kylie is affectionately called the "Princess of Pop." Regarding her personal life, Kylie was diagnosed with breast cancer in 2005 but fought it bravely and made a full recovery. Following her treatment, she has been vocal about her journey to raise awareness and inspire others who are battling cancer.

Did you know

What is Kylie Minogue's most famous song? Kylie Minogue's most famous song is "Can't Get You Out of My Head," released in 2001.
Has Kylie Minogue ever acted in movies? Yes, Kylie Minogue has acted in movies such as "Moulin Rouge!" and "Street Fighter."
What is Kylie Minogue's connection to the fashion industry? Kylie Minogue is known for her iconic fashion sense and has collaborated with various designers for her stage outfits.
How has Kylie Minogue contributed to charitable causes? Kylie Minogue has supported various charitable causes, including cancer research and HIV/AIDS awareness.
